Tumbling Classes

At Xtreme Athletics, we pride ourselves in teaching correct and safe technique through the use of drills, conditioning, and hands on training. We believe in "Perfection before Progression", in which a skill should be perfected before moving on to more difficult skills in order to set the athlete up for success in the future. We offer adult age coaches who have spent years learning the best techniques to teach athletes of all varying skill levels and learning styles.

Intro to Tumbling

Introduction to tumbling! In this class, athletes will begin learning the basics to tumbling through drills and introductory tumbling skills. They will continue to build on those skills to further their tumbling capabilities. Perfect for beginners and those who have completed our Cadet Academy!

​

Skills to be learned: Forward roll, backward roll, handstand, front limber, back bend, cartwheel, single arm cartwheel

 

Prerequisites:  no skills required

 

Tumble 1: Tumbling Foundations

In this class, athletes will range from early stages of back kickovers up to front and back walkovers. They will continue working towards the perfection of multiple walkovers by building on the basics of tumbling through drills and practice.

​

Skills to be learned: Forward roll, backward roll, handstand, front limber, front walkover, back bend, back bend kickover, back walkover, headstands, cartwheel, single arm cartwheel, round off, opposite leg back walkover

 

Prerequisites:  Complete Intro to Tumbling and/or forward roll, backward roll, handstand, cartwheel, backbend

​

Tumble 2: Training and Perfecting Back Handsprings

In this class, athletes will range from early stages of back handsprings up to single / double back handsprings. They will continue working towards the perfection of multiple back handsprings & powerful rebounds.

​

Skills to be learned: Round off back handspring(s), standing back handspring(s), back walkover back handspring, front walkover/front handspring, toe-touch back handspring, cartwheel back handspring

​

Prerequisites (these skills should be of high quality and are required for placement in this class): forward roll, backward roll, handstand, back bend, back walkover, cartwheel, round off, front walkover

 

Tumble 3: Tuck Training and More

In this class, athletes will range from early stages of back tucks (running tumbling) to having a solid back tuck on the floor. They will also begin working towards perfecting standing tumbling up to multiple back handsprings. 

​

Skills to be learned: round off back tuck, round off back handspring back tuck, front tuck, standing back tuck, specialty passes with forward and backward traveling skills, back handspring step out through to other skills, layout drills and working layouts

​

Prerequisites (these skills should be of high quality and are required for placement in this class):  Round off back handsprings (min. of 3), standing back handsprings (min. of 3), back walkover back handspring, front walkover/front handspring, toe-touch back handspring, cartwheel back handspring

 

Tumble 4: Layouts and Beyond

In our most advanced class, athletes will learn and perfect some of the highest skills. These range from working running layouts and standing tucks to working on full twisting layouts, back handsprings to full, standing full. 

​

Skills to be learned: Round off back handspring layout, standing and running combination to tuck/layout/full, front tuck step out through to other skills, standing full, running full, combination jumps into back tuck, whips, front layouts, ariels, arabians

​

Prerequisites (these skills should be of high quality and are required for placement in this class): round off back tuck, round off back handspring back tuck, front tuck, standing back tuck, specialty passes with forward and backward traveling skills
